However, as the write-up "What Else Should We Do?" checked out, there are various other means to define approach within the lawful services market. In this article, nevertheless, we look much less at the substanceor also the meritsof any type of specific method and rather examine the history of how strategy as an idea developed within law practice and therein the major gamers driving its advancement and application.


Steven Adair MacDonald & Partners

It was mainly informal, lacking the elegance more usual in companies and huge markets. Wilkins notes, "Originally it was simply legal representatives servicing method, however not all the firm's lawyers. Early law-firm-strategy formation was normally just a tiny team of partnersthe managing partner, possibly some participants of the executive board.

As Empson says, "People were not required to ask the challenging concerns around technique so long as the cash was rolling in. Early technique development was usually just a tiny team of companions.


Wilkins, professors director, HLS Fixate the Legal Profession This altered with the GFC. "The economic downturn hit, and all of a sudden challenging decisions needed to be made," says Empson. "These sort of decisionsbeing firmwide and time-sensitiverequired cumulative action, which suggested power relocated away from the relatively independent individual companions and coalesced around individuals that were eventually responsible for leading the firmin theory, the handling and senior partners." This, Empson discusses, led many firms to adopt more-systematic procedures for partner efficiency administration, which consequently led to adjustments in settlement systems and considerable partner departures.

In other words, the need for strategy ran amok. In such a hypercompetitive climate, having a little group of senior legal representatives vowing to do outstanding job was no more a viable technique. Wilkins notes, "After the GFC and the failing of several popular law firms, individuals obtained really terrified. They saw that if you really did not have a strategyor worse yet, if you had a poor method of just growing by jumps and bounds, extensively employing laterals without any kind of concept of just how to incorporate them, or attempting to be in all markets at all timesthen it might truly be a catastrophe." While the value of method has actually been intensified over time, this does not respond to the concern of that is guiding strategyand exactly how.


They are each part owners, and jointly they are the proprietor. Inspirations, whether commercial, prestige, or some various other calculated aim, are essential to the company just inasmuch as they are necessary to the companions (breach of lease lawyer). Thus, an approach has little hope of taking impact without the support of the basic partnership, making the collaboration's buy-in vital for any plan's success.


"Law practice need to at the same time bring in and keep customers and bring in and retain expert staffotherwise they have no item or no solution to deliver to the client." But the tale is not that easy, as there is an extra subtlety to the partnership between the collaboration and firm method. Unlike in a typical public firm, in a law practice, in addition to the overall firm strategy, private partners are developing methods of their ownfor circumstances, about their clients and their techniques.
